Resistance Measurement
First test meter and leads by touching leads
together. Resistance should read a short circuit
(very low resistance)
Circuit power must be turned OFF before testing
resistance
Disconnect component from circuit before testing
If meter is not auto ranging, set it to the correct
range (See multimeter’s operation manual)
Use firm contact with meter leads
Continuity Measurement
Some meters require a separate button press to
enable audible continuity testing
Circuit power must be turned OFF before testing
continuity
Disconnect component from circuit before testing
Use firm contact with meter leads
First test meter and leads by touching leads
together. Meter should produce an audible alarm,
indicating continuity
